  1. Anyone heard of/like this band? They are Australian and playing the Edinburgh fringe soon.

    I have to warn all of you that they are not heavy at all. Infact they don't even touch on the 'emotional' themes that are rife in alternative music these days; the general gist that runs through most of the album is having fun.

    Quote:

    'The 'Empire have managed to combine Madness-esque Ska with jazz with hip-hop with break beats with reggae, and instead of sounding like a pretentious piece of mumbo-jumbo they actually sound incredible.

    The only album they've released ("The Cat Empire) is a tribute to their amazing energy that they pump out at their live shows (although i've not been to one, this is what i've been informed by various fans...)'

    I can say this: if you like jazz, ska, skate punk, anything that involves feeling really really good or anything summery, then listen to these guys - you'll be impressed.

    After having started on story of the year, disturbed have decided to have a go at finch:

    From the official Finch site: ""To anyone who either witnessed or heard about today's incident at the Rolling Rock Town Fair. While we were setting up, one of the members of Disturbed, Dan Donegan, was harassing us from the side of the stage. Before we were to play, Randy (our guitarist) walked over to Dan to explain that the comments he made a few years ago were a joke, and to give him a friendly handshake. Dan proceeded to assault Randy and Disturbed's singer, David Draiman, attacked Mike Herrara (our drum tech) which caused a fight to ensue. We want everyone to know that Finch did not start this fight. However, we do not take kindly to being assaulted or having our lives threatened. We would like this little conflict to be resolved as soon as possible, but we will not give in to bullying bands threatening us or our fans.""
